To: The Detroit Free Press
Re: “Ford buyout plan chills UAW locals”, Aug. 23
The Ford buyout plan for its hourly workers is a good deal for the company and the workers opting to accept the plan but leaders of UAW locals are opposed to the plan, “Ford buyout plan chills UAW locals”, Aug. 23.
It appears that even though the buyout plan is great for UAW members, it’s really all about the UAW and its leaders; they fear extinction and want the leaving workers replaced.
With the U.S. auto industry in a fight for its very life, the UAW, realizing that they are part of the problem, should allow its members to leave while the leaving is good and have the last member leaving, just turn off the lights.
